Optimum Size of Architectural Models for Tactile Exploration -- Application of 3D Printers to the Education and Welfare of the Blind --
Tetsuya Watanabe, Kana Sato (Niigata Univ.) ET2018-6

(in English) Three-dimensional (3D) printers are useful in the education and welfare of the blind. However, there is any established guidelines on the adequate size of models that are made by the use of 3D printers. We, therefore, made three sizes (6 cm, 12 cm, 18 cm) of models of six architectures with different complexities and conducted an experiment in which the participants explored these models and were asked to answer to the questions on the physical features of the architectures and to evaluate each sized models. The results of the physical feature quizzes showed difficulty in detecting little dots (a few milimeters) in small-sized (6 cm) models and dented structures in all sizes, and different impressions given by different sizes. The largest sized (18 cm) models gained the highest ratings for all architectures whereas even smaller sizes were understandable as for less complicated architectures.
